低代碼平臺在高校門戶網(wǎng)站建設(shè)中的深度應(yīng)用與影響(低代碼平臺的設(shè)計與實(shí)現(xiàn))
隨著信息技術(shù)的飛速發(fā)展和數(shù)字化轉(zhuǎn)型的浪潮,高校門戶網(wǎng)站作為學(xué)校對外展示形象、提供信息、互動交流的重要平臺,其建設(shè)質(zhì)量直接關(guān)系到學(xué)校的品牌形象、信息傳遞效率和社會影響力。傳統(tǒng)的門戶網(wǎng)站開發(fā)方式不僅需要投入大量的人力、物力和時間,而且面臨著維護(hù)困難、更新滯后等問題,已經(jīng)無法滿足現(xiàn)代高校門戶網(wǎng)站建設(shè)的需求。近年來,低代碼平臺的出現(xiàn),以其高效、靈活、易用的特點(diǎn),為高校門戶網(wǎng)站建設(shè)帶來了革命性的變革。
一、低代碼平臺的定義與特點(diǎn)
低代碼平臺是一種基于可視化建模、模板化設(shè)計和自動化生成技術(shù)的應(yīng)用開發(fā)平臺。它通過提供豐富的模板、組件庫、拖拽操作、自動化生成等功能,使得開發(fā)者無需編寫大量的代碼,即可通過簡單的拖拽、配置和少量編程,快速構(gòu)建出功能豐富的應(yīng)用程序。低代碼平臺的特點(diǎn)主要體現(xiàn)在以下幾個方面:
易用性:低代碼平臺通過直觀的可視化界面和拖拽操作,極大地降低了開發(fā)門檻。開發(fā)者無需具備深厚的編程技能,只需通過簡單的拖拽和配置即可完成應(yīng)用程序的開發(fā)。平臺提供了詳細(xì)的文檔和教程,幫助開發(fā)者快速上手。同時,平臺還支持多種開發(fā)模式和工具,如可視化編輯器、代碼編輯器、調(diào)試工具等,以滿足不同開發(fā)者的需求和習(xí)慣。這些工具和模式的設(shè)計充分考慮了開發(fā)者的使用習(xí)慣和學(xué)習(xí)曲線,使得開發(fā)者能夠更加高效地利用低代碼平臺進(jìn)行開發(fā)。
高效性:低代碼平臺通過模板化設(shè)計和自動化生成技術(shù),顯著提高了開發(fā)效率。開發(fā)者可以利用平臺提供的模板和組件庫,快速搭建出符合設(shè)計要求的門戶網(wǎng)站框架,從而大幅縮短開發(fā)周期。同時,平臺還支持快速迭代和更新,使得門戶網(wǎng)站能夠隨時適應(yīng)學(xué)校的發(fā)展需求。此外,平臺還提供了高效的協(xié)作和版本控制功能,方便多個開發(fā)者同時進(jìn)行開發(fā)和維護(hù)工作,進(jìn)一步提高了開發(fā)效率。
靈活性:低代碼平臺支持個性化定制和二次開發(fā),能夠滿足不同高校門戶網(wǎng)站建設(shè)的獨(dú)特需求。開發(fā)者可以根據(jù)學(xué)校的實(shí)際需求,對網(wǎng)站進(jìn)行個性化定制和功能的拓展。平臺提供了豐富的API接口和插件機(jī)制,方便開發(fā)者進(jìn)行二次開發(fā)和集成其他系統(tǒng)。同時,平臺還支持多種部署方式和云服務(wù),以滿足不同高校的部署和擴(kuò)展需求。這種靈活性使得低代碼平臺能夠適應(yīng)各種復(fù)雜和多變的需求場景,為高校門戶網(wǎng)站建設(shè)提供了更加全面和強(qiáng)大的支持。
二、低代碼平臺在高校門戶網(wǎng)站建設(shè)中的應(yīng)用細(xì)節(jié)
網(wǎng)站框架搭建:低代碼平臺提供了豐富的模板和組件庫,包括導(dǎo)航欄、輪播圖、表單、文章列表等常用的網(wǎng)站元素。開發(fā)者可以根據(jù)學(xué)校的需求選擇適合的模板,通過拖拽和配置的方式快速搭建出符合設(shè)計要求的門戶網(wǎng)站框架。同時,平臺還支持自定義樣式和布局,使得網(wǎng)站更加美觀和個性化。在搭建過程中,開發(fā)者還可以利用平臺的預(yù)覽功能實(shí)時查看網(wǎng)站效果,確保搭建出的網(wǎng)站框架符合學(xué)校的要求。
功能模塊開發(fā):傳統(tǒng)的門戶網(wǎng)站開發(fā)需要開發(fā)者編寫大量的代碼來實(shí)現(xiàn)各種功能模塊,而低代碼平臺通過提供可視化的功能模塊和組件,簡化了開發(fā)過程。開發(fā)者只需通過簡單的配置和拖拽操作即可完成功能模塊的開發(fā),無需編寫復(fù)雜的代碼。例如,平臺提供了用戶管理、內(nèi)容管理、權(quán)限管理等常見的功能模塊,開發(fā)者只需進(jìn)行簡單的配置即可實(shí)現(xiàn)這些功能。這大大降低了開發(fā)的難度和工作量,提高了開發(fā)效率。
數(shù)據(jù)集成與交互:高校門戶網(wǎng)站通常需要與其他系統(tǒng)進(jìn)行數(shù)據(jù)集成和交互,如教務(wù)系統(tǒng)、學(xué)生管理系統(tǒng)等。低代碼平臺提供了豐富的API接口和插件機(jī)制,方便開發(fā)者進(jìn)行數(shù)據(jù)的集成和交互。開發(fā)者可以利用平臺提供的API接口與其他系統(tǒng)進(jìn)行對接,實(shí)現(xiàn)數(shù)據(jù)的共享和交換。同時,平臺還支持自定義插件的開發(fā),開發(fā)者可以根據(jù)實(shí)際需求編寫插件來實(shí)現(xiàn)特定的功能或與其他系統(tǒng)進(jìn)行更深入的集成。
響應(yīng)式設(shè)計與移動端支持:隨著移動互聯(lián)網(wǎng)的普及和發(fā)展,高校門戶網(wǎng)站需要具備良好的響應(yīng)式設(shè)計和移動端支持能力。低代碼平臺提供了響應(yīng)式設(shè)計的支持,開發(fā)者可以輕松地創(chuàng)建適應(yīng)不同設(shè)備的網(wǎng)站布局和樣式。同時,平臺還支持移動端的開發(fā)和優(yōu)化,確保門戶網(wǎng)站在移動設(shè)備上的訪問體驗(yàn)良好。
安全性與可靠性保障:高校門戶網(wǎng)站的安全性至關(guān)重要。低代碼平臺在設(shè)計和實(shí)現(xiàn)過程中充分考慮了安全性和可靠性問題。平臺提供了多種安全機(jī)制,如身份驗(yàn)證、訪問控制、數(shù)據(jù)加密等,確保網(wǎng)站的數(shù)據(jù)安全和用戶隱私。同時,平臺還提供了自動化的備份和恢復(fù)功能,確保網(wǎng)站數(shù)據(jù)的安全性和可靠性。此外,平臺還經(jīng)過了嚴(yán)格的安全測試和漏洞掃描,確保在使用過程中不會受到惡意攻擊和漏洞利用。
三、低代碼平臺助力高校門戶網(wǎng)站建設(shè)的案例分析
以某知名高校為例,該校采用低代碼平臺建設(shè)了新版門戶網(wǎng)站。通過平臺提供的模板和組件庫,學(xué)??焖俅罱ǔ隽司哂絮r明特色的網(wǎng)站框架,并在短時間內(nèi)實(shí)現(xiàn)了網(wǎng)站上線。在后續(xù)的維護(hù)和更新過程中,學(xué)校利用低代碼平臺的靈活性和高效性,不斷對網(wǎng)站進(jìn)行優(yōu)化和升級。例如,學(xué)校通過平臺提供的可視化編輯器輕松添加了新的功能模塊、調(diào)整了網(wǎng)站布局、更新了網(wǎng)站內(nèi)容等。
綜上所述,低代碼平臺在高校門戶網(wǎng)站建設(shè)中的應(yīng)用帶來了諸多好處,包括提升開發(fā)效率、降低技術(shù)門檻、增強(qiáng)靈活性與適應(yīng)性、提升用戶體驗(yàn)以及加強(qiáng)數(shù)據(jù)治理與安全等。隨著低代碼技術(shù)的不斷發(fā)展和完善,相信未來它在高校門戶網(wǎng)站建設(shè)中的應(yīng)用將更加廣泛和深入。